Default vlookup in VBA

I just tested this for one
x = Application.VLookup(Cells(1, "d"), Range("f1:i6"), 2, 0)

or

For i = 1 To 9
Cells(i, "f") = Application.VLookup(Cells(i, "b"), Range("g1:i6"), 2, 0)
Next i

I am using Excell 2000 with Windows 2000 Professional.
I am trying to get the result of a vlookup into a cell by using

For I = 2 To numrows
Cells(I, "F") = Evaluate("=VLOOKUP(cells(i, "B"),Box_Log,6)")

Next I

I get a "Compile Error: Expected list separator or )" at the "B".
What gives?
